Abstract

The utility model discloses a kind of double screw extruders, are related to extruder technology field, its key points of the technical solution are that:Including holder, the fuselage being fixedly connected on holder and the twin-screw being arranged in fuselage, described fuselage one end is fixedly connected with spout, the fuselage other end is provided with discharge port, the fuselage includes multiple machine barrels being arranged in series, it is both provided with one of exhaust outlet on each road machine barrel, the fuselage upper end is provided with an exhaust pipe, the first branch pipe of more connections each road exhaust outlets and exhaust pipe is provided on exhaust pipe, two vacuum pumps are added on exhaust pipe, and two the second branch pipes that setting is connected to vacuum pump are provided on exhaust pipe;Vacuum pump is enable to carry out pumping work to each operating position of double screw extruder by the cooperation of the first branch pipe, the second branch pipe and exhaust pipe, for single-point pumping, pumping effect is more preferable.

Background technology
In the production process of film, it is that powder is packed into feedstock barrel, passes through extruder for shaping.But it is squeezing out During, due to the presence of melt small molecule and moisture, and powder will produce part volatile organic in the molten state Close object so that the admixture of gas that aqueous vapor and volatile organic compounds are had in machine barrel can cause centainly the quality of product Influence, the method for being usually removed admixture of gas be on machine barrel increase a vacuum pump admixture of gas is taken away, still Vacuum extractor needs are periodically safeguarded, and only complete equipment can just remain in operation after safeguarding completion, in this way It can cause the delay of manufacturing schedule.
Application publication number be CN102285089A Chinese patent disclose a kind of double screw extruder, including spout with And the twin-screw being arranged in machine barrel, exhaust outlet is provided on the twin-screw, exhaust outlet is vacuumized by exhaust pipe connection The first vacuum pump, the exhaust pipe have exhaust manifold, the exhaust manifold connect the second vacuum pump, described first The front end of vacuum pump and the second vacuum pump is respectively arranged with the first valve and the second valve.
When normal work, the first, second valve can be opened, two sets of vacuum pumps is made all to work, needs to tie up when wherein a set of It is another set of to can continue to work when shield or stopping;But double screw extruder is when working, powder in the molten state each A stage will produce volatile organic compounds, be difficult by powder by exhaust pipe, the first vacuum pump and the second vacuum pump The volatile organic compounds inside contained is completely drawn out so that the quality of product can still be affected.
Utility model content
In view of the deficienciess of the prior art, the purpose of this utility model is to provide a kind of double screw extruder, have Realize the effect of better gas bleeding mixture in twin-screw extruder extrusion process.
To achieve the above object, the utility model provides following technical solution:
A kind of double screw extruder, including holder, the fuselage being fixedly connected on holder and pair being arranged in fuselage Screw rod, described fuselage one end are fixedly connected with spout, and the fuselage other end is provided with discharge port, and the fuselage includes multiple The machine barrel being arranged in series is both provided with one of exhaust outlet on each road machine barrel, and the fuselage upper end is provided with an exhaust pipe, row It is provided with the first branch pipe of more connections each road exhaust outlets and exhaust pipe on tracheae, two vacuum pumps are added on exhaust pipe, Two the second branch pipes that setting is connected to vacuum pump are provided on exhaust pipe.
So set, passing through the cooperation of the first branch pipe and exhaust pipe so that be connected to setting with exhaust pipe by the second branch pipe Vacuum pump can carry out pumping work to each road cylinder, to realize more preferably more fully be evacuated effect so that product is more It is solid.
Further setting:It is both provided with the first shut-off valve on each first branch pipe.
So set, being made it possible to according to actual needs using the first shut-off valve to select the position of pumping so that work Range is wider.
Further setting:It is both provided with the second shut-off valve on each second branch pipe.
So set, when a wherein vacuum pump is needed to suspend and be safeguarded, it can be close by the second branch pipe by the second cut-off Envelope, another can work on, and will not delay manufacturing schedule, and will not extract air outward by the second branch pipe.
Further setting:The exhaust pipe includes multistage transverse tube, is connected to by T shape pipes between two transverse tubes being disposed adjacent Setting, the first branch pipe of each road and the second branch pipe, which are connected to by the roads T Xing Guanyuge transverse tube, to be arranged.
So set, when part transverse tube, the first branch pipe or the second branch pipe damage, can be incited somebody to action by detaching T shape pipes The pipeline of damage carries out dismounting and change, all disassembles exhaust pipe, the second branch pipe and the first branch pipe without needing to change, and saves Replacing construction.
Further setting:It is fastenedly connected by clip between the T shapes pipe and other pipelines.
So set, using clip ensure between T shapes pipe and other pipelines the case where being fastenedly connected, avoid shedding Occur.
Further setting:Cooling tube is arranged in first pipe outer wall, water inlet, institute is arranged in the cooling tube lower end It states cooling tube upper end and is provided with water outlet.
So set, carrying a large amount of heat when admixture of gas is extracted, one can be caused to vacuum pump after long-time service Fixed damage, causes service life of vacuum pump to reduce, by water inlet to inputting cold water in cooling tube, then in the first branch pipe Admixture of gas cool down, to prevent damage of the high-temperature gas to vacuum pump.
Further setting:It is both provided with sealing ring between the cooling tube upper and lower ends and a pipe outer wall.
So set, avoiding gap leakage of the cooling water between cooling tube and the first branch pipe.
Further setting:It is provided with connector on the machine barrel, is provided on the connector and is plugged in for the first branch pipe Through-hole in exhaust outlet is provided with refractory seals set between first branch pipe and through-hole.
So set, pushing double screw extruder to replace operating position convenient for staff.
Further setting:The pedestal lower end is provided with multiple adjusting lower margins.
So set, making double screw extruder that can also keep horizontal on broken terrain using lower margin is adjusted Working condition.
By using above-mentioned technical proposal, the utility model is compared compared with the prior art:Pass through the first branch pipe, the second branch pipe And the cooperation of exhaust pipe enables vacuum pump to carry out pumping work to each operating position of double screw extruder, relative to For single-point pumping, pumping effect is more preferable.

Specific implementation mode
Double screw extruder is described further referring to figs. 1 to Fig. 3.
A kind of double screw extruder, as shown in Figure 1, including holder 1, the fuselage 2 being fixedly connected on holder 1 and setting For blending the twin-screw 24 for squeezing powder in fuselage 2,1 lower end of holder is fixedly connected with multiple so that twin-screw extrusion function Enough adjusting lower margins 11 that horizontal operation state is kept on broken terrain, 2 one end of fuselage are fixedly connected with spout 22, 2 other end of fuselage is provided with discharge port 23, and the machine barrel 21 that fuselage 2 is arranged by multi-section serial forms;Wherein, 2 upper end of fuselage is arranged There are an exhaust pipe 3 being arranged along 2 length direction of fuselage and two vacuum pumps 4, more connection exhausts are provided on exhaust pipe 3 Pipe 3 is connected to the first branch pipe 32 of setting with 21 inside of machine barrel, and more connection vacuum pumps 4 and exhaust pipe 3 are additionally provided on exhaust pipe 3 The second branch pipe 31.
Wherein, the first shut-off valve for closed barrier machine barrel 21 and exhaust pipe 3 is both provided on each first branch pipe 32 321, the second shut-off valve 311 for closed barrier exhaust pipe 3 and vacuum pump 4 is both provided on each second branch pipe 31.
In conjunction with shown in Fig. 1 and Fig. 2, exhaust pipe 3 includes multistage transverse tube 33, passes through T between two transverse tubes 33 being disposed adjacent The connection setting of shape pipe 34, each road the first branch pipe 32 and the second branch pipe 31 are connected to setting by T shapes pipe 34 with each transverse tube 33; Wherein, it is fastenedly connected by clip 35 between T shapes pipe 34 and other pipelines.
In conjunction with shown in Fig. 2 and Fig. 3, cooling tube 36, the setting of 36 lower end of the cooling tube are arranged on 32 outer wall of the first branch pipe Water inlet 362,36 upper end of the cooling tube are provided with water outlet 361, wherein outside 36 upper and lower ends of cooling tube and the first branch pipe 32 The sealing ring 363 for preventing cooling water from revealing is both provided between wall.
Wherein, water inlet 362 is connected to setting with extraneous water pump, and water outlet 361 is connected to setting with external water pipe.
In conjunction with shown in Fig. 1 and Fig. 3, each 21 upper surface of road machine barrel is both provided with one of exhaust outlet 211, and 21 upper surface of machine barrel is logical It crosses bolt to be fixedly connected there are one connector 5, the through-hole of 211 bank of exhaust outlet connection setting, the first branch pipe is provided on connector 5 32 lower ends are plugged in through-hole, wherein are provided between the first branch pipe 32 and connector 5 for preventing admixture of gas from connection The refractory seals set 51 that gap leaks out between part 5 and the first branch pipe 32.
Operation principle:When double screw extruder produces, as needed, it can select to be single by the second shut-off valve 311 Vacuum pump 4 is evacuated or two vacuum pumps 4 are evacuated, while the pumping of double screw extruder can be selected by the first shut-off valve 321 Position so that the scope of application is wider.
When certain segment pipe damages, the first shut-off valve 321 for connecting the segment pipe can be closed, then by connecing The segment pipe both ends clip 35 is touched to its fixed effect, you can the segment pipe is removed, and is directly replaced, structure letter It is single, it is easy to operate.
